'Coming Home' is a song that captures the essence of personal redemption and the journey towards self-discovery. Released as a part of P Diddy's collaborative project with his group Dirty Money, the track features vocals by Skylar Grey and was produced by a team including Alex da Kid and Jay-Z. The song's lyrics reflect P Diddy's introspection and acknowledgment of past mistakes, offering a message of hope and renewal. It resonates with listeners who have experienced similar struggles and are on their own paths to healing.

The chorus, sung by Skylar Grey, is particularly poignant, emphasizing the relief and peace that come with finding one's way back home, both literally and metaphorically. The verses delve into themes of regret, forgiveness, and the desire to make amends, painting a vivid picture of the emotional turmoil and eventual clarity experienced by the narrator. 'Coming Home' is not just a personal anthem for P Diddy but a universal song that speaks to anyone who has faced adversity and is striving to overcome it.
